CSS를 사용하여 요소의 그림자 효과를 얻는 방법
CSS를 사용하여 요소의 그림자 효과를 구현하는 방법에는 특정 코드 예제가 필요합니다.
웹 디자인에서 그림자 효과는 페이지 요소에 입체감과 레이어링을 추가하여 페이지를 더욱 풍성하고 생생하게 만들 수 있습니다. . CSS(Cascading Style Sheets)는 그림자 효과를 구현하기 위한 다양한 방법과 속성을 제공합니다.
1. box-shadow 속성
box-shadow 속성은 요소 그림자 효과를 달성하는 데 사용되는 CSS3의 새로운 속성입니다. 요소에 box-shadow 속성을 추가하면 요소에 그림자 효과를 주어 요소가 페이지 밖으로 떠오르게 하고 3차원 효과를 강화할 수 있습니다.
box-shadow 속성의 구문은 다음과 같습니다.
box-shadow: h-shadow v-shadow 흐림 확산 색상 삽입
이 중 각 매개변수의 구체적인 의미는 다음과 같습니다.
- h- 그림자: 양수 값(오른쪽) 또는 음수 값(왼쪽)일 수 있는 수평 그림자 위치
- v-shadow: 양수(아래) 또는 음수(위)일 수 있는 수직 그림자 위치; 흐림: 흐림 거리, 값은 0에서 양의 무한대 사이의 값입니다. 값이 클수록 흐림 정도가 높아집니다.
- 확산: 그림자 크기 확장, 값이 음수이면 그림자가 축소됩니다. 요소 내부에서 값이 양수 값이면 그림자가 요소 외부로 확장됩니다.
- color: 그림자 색상, 색상 값, RGB 값 또는 16진수 값을 사용할 수 있습니다. 값이 지정되면 그림자 효과는 내부 그림자가 됩니다.
- 다음은 그림자 효과가 있는 텍스트 상자를 구현하는 구체적인 코드 예입니다.
<!DOCTYPE html> <html> <head> <style> .shadow-box { width: 200px; height: 40px; padding: 10px; border: none; border-radius: 5px; box-shadow: 2px 2px 5px 2px rgba(0, 0, 0, 0.5); } </style> </head> <body> <input type="text" class="shadow-box" placeholder="请输入内容"> </body> </html>
로그인 후 복사위 코드에서 입력 상자에 Shadow-box 클래스 스타일을 추가하면 그림자 효과가 있는 텍스트 상자가 생성됩니다. 효과 텍스트 상자를 구현했습니다. box-shadow 속성의 값은 "2px 2px 5px 2px rgba(0, 0, 0, 0.5)"로 설정됩니다. 이는 수평 및 수직 그림자 위치가 모두 2px, 흐림 거리가 5px, 그림자 크기가 5px임을 의미합니다. 2px로 확장되고 그림자 색상은 검정색이며 투명도는 0.5입니다.
2. Text-shadow 속성
box-shadow 속성 외에도 CSS는 텍스트에 그림자 효과를 주기 위해 text-shadow 속성도 제공합니다. 텍스트 요소에 text-shadow 속성을 추가하면 텍스트에 그림자 효과를 추가하여 텍스트를 더욱 눈에 띄고 입체적으로 만들 수 있습니다. text-shadow 속성의 구문은 다음과 같습니다.text-shadow: h-shadow v-shadow 흐림 색상
- 색상: 그림자 색상, 색상 값, RGB 값 또는 16진수 값을 사용할 수 있습니다. 다음은 그림자 효과를 적용한 제목을 구현한 구체적인 코드 예시입니다.
<!DOCTYPE html> <html> <head> <style> .shadow-title { font-size: 24px; color: #333; text-shadow: 2px 2px 5px rgba(0, 0, 0, 0.5); } </style> </head> <body> <h1 id="投影效果标题">投影效果标题</h1> </body> </html>
로그인 후 복사위 코드에서는 title 요소에 Shadow-title 클래스 스타일을 추가하여 그림자 효과를 적용한 제목을 구현했습니다. . text-shadow 속성의 값은 "2px 2px 5px rgba(0, 0, 0, 0.5)"로 설정됩니다. 즉, 가로 및 세로 그림자 위치는 모두 2px, 흐림 거리는 5px, 그림자 색상은 검정색이고 투명도는 0.5입니다. - 위의 코드 예를 통해 CSS의 box-shadow 및 text-shadow 속성을 사용하여 요소의 그림자 효과를 쉽게 얻을 수 있음을 알 수 있습니다. 실제 개발에서는 페이지의 시각적 효과와 사용자 경험을 향상시키기 위해 다양한 투영 효과를 달성하기 위해 특정 요구에 따라 매개변수 값과 색상 설정을 조정할 수 있습니다.
위 내용은 CSS를 사용하여 요소의 그림자 효과를 얻는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











Svelte Transition API는 맞춤형 전환을 포함하여 문서를 입력하거나 떠날 때 구성 요소를 애니메이션하는 방법을 제공합니다.

웹 사이트의 컨텐츠 프레젠테이션을 설계하는 데 얼마나 많은 시간을 소비합니까? 새 블로그 게시물을 작성하거나 새 페이지를 만들 때

최근 Bitcoin의 가격이 20k 달러가 넘는 USD가 최근에 등반되면서 최근 30k를 끊었으므로 Ethereum을 만드는 데 깊이 다이빙을 할 가치가 있다고 생각했습니다.

NPM 명령은 서버 시작 또는 컴파일 코드와 같은 것들에 대한 일회성 또는 지속적으로 실행되는 프로세스로 다양한 작업을 실행합니다.

이 기사에서는 그림자 및 그라디언트와 같은 텍스트 효과에 CSS를 사용하여 성능을 최적화하고 사용자 경험을 향상시킵니다. 초보자를위한 리소스도 나열됩니다. (159 자)

나는 다른 날에 Eric Meyer와 대화를 나누고 있었고 나는 내 형성 시절부터 Eric Meyer 이야기를 기억했습니다. CSS 특이성에 대한 블로그 게시물을 썼습니다

개발자로서 어느 단계에 있든, 우리가 완료 한 작업은 크든 작든, 개인적이고 전문적인 성장에 큰 영향을 미칩니다.
